Output d20c80059c19f8a73fdb7af3fc078a9d867e9fb327e1918cc6a8d5944a189203:20

value
11914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c7ca8203e078d335d05a631c2705ceaec11db9 OP_EQUAL
address
33atn75aoH92KUq11KMzEWhVBYRU4v6F7X
transaction
d20c80059c19f8a73fdb7af3fc078a9d867e9fb327e1918cc6a8d5944a189203
confirmations
44647
spent
true